When filing a lawsuit, the timeline will vary based on the type of case being pursued and the jurisdiction in which it is filed. However, there are some common steps that can be taken to prepare for a potential wrongful death lawsuit in Lakewood Ranch, Florida.
First, an individual should consult with an experienced wrongful death lawyer, who can provide sound legal advice and help with the filing process. The lawyer will review all of the facts, medical records, and other evidence relevant to the case before determining whether a lawsuit is warranted.
Next, the wrongful death lawyer will draft and file a complaint with the appropriate court in Lakewood Ranch, Florida. This document lays out why a lawsuit should be filed and outlines the specific damages being sought. The complaint will then be served to the defendant, who has a certain amount of time to respond.
From there, both sides may engage in discovery, which involves requesting documents and conducting depositions with witnesses. Depending on the outcome of these proceedings, it is possible that the parties could enter settlement negotiations.

Wrongful death claims in Lakewood Ranch, Florida are subject to the state’s statute of limitations laws. Generally speaking, a wrongful death claim must be filed within two years of the date of death. However, there may be exceptions to this rule depending on the facts of your particular case.

Most wrongful death lawyers in Lakewood Ranch, Florida operate on a contingency fee basis, meaning that their fees are based on a percentage of the proceeds from any successful settlement or verdict. This allows individuals with limited financial resources to receive quality legal representation without having to pay any upfront costs. The lawyer’s fee is typically between 33-40% of the total amount recovered from a settlement.
